Everglide Concept Gadget: Ability to be wheeled, backpacked or cycled
Here is a concept gadget, which has been developed by a Student Designer named Frag Woodall who calls his product by the name of Everglide that is essentially an built-in solution for short distance travel with the capability of being wheeled, cycled or back-packed.

Frag Woodall is a student at the University of Technology in Sydney and the Everglide is one of the finalists of the Australian Design Award. The newly designed concept is aimed at providing its user a form of transport, which can be carried with you on other forms of transport such as trains and buses.
The design is said to be consisted with a sort of shaft drive mechanism that is really light weight and compacted, one of my preferred characteristics of the Everglide concept is the frictionless magnetic dynamo technology which allows users to connect devices as iPods and phones to be regeneratively charged.
